Step-by-Step Cooking Process
1. Preheat the oven to 300°F (150°C).
2. Season the short ribs with salt and pepper.
3. Heat oil in a large oven-safe pot over medium-high heat.
4. Brown the short ribs on all sides, about 3-4 minutes per side.
5. Remove the ribs and set aside.
6. In the same pot, sauté chopped onions, carrots, and celery until soft.
7. Add min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
8. Pour in red wine, scraping up any browned bits from the pot.
9. Return the short ribs to the pot and add beef broth and herbs.
10. Cover and transfer to the oven; cook for 2.5-3 hours until tender.

Storage and Reheating
Store leftover short ribs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, warm them slowly in a saucepan over low heat. They can also be frozen for up to 3 months; thaw in the refrigerator before reheating.

FAQs
How do I know when the short ribs are done?
The short ribs are done when they are fork-tender and have an internal temperature of around 200°F (93°C). They should easily pull apart with a fork.
Can I make this recipe in a slow cooker?
Yes, you can make short ribs in a slow cooker. Brown the meat first, then transfer everything to the sl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ours.
What can I serve with short ribs?
Short ribs pair well with mashed potatoes, roasted vegetables, or a fresh salad. For a hearty meal, serve with crusty bread.
Can I use wine alternatives?
If you prefer not to use wine, beef broth can be used as an alternative. You can also use grape juice or a vinegar-based solution for acidity.

Short Ribs Recipe
Ingredients
- 4 short ribs
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 onion chopped
- 2 carrots chopped
- 2 celery stalks chopped
- 4 cloves garlic minced
- 1 cup red wine
- 2 cups beef broth
- 2 sprigs fresh thyme
- 2 sprigs fresh rosemary
